Understanding Data⁣ Privacy in EdTech

Data ‌privacy refers to the protection and⁤ proper handling of⁤ personal ⁤and​ sensitive information collected by digital platforms. In the context of EdTech, this means securing student records, assessment data, learning habits, ‍interaction logs, and more.

With platforms ranging from online ⁤learning management systems (LMS) to‌ adaptive educational apps,schools are generating and‍ storing ‍vast amounts of⁣ data ‍daily.

  • personal Information: ⁣ names, addresses, emails, birth dates
  • Academic Records: Grades, assignments, test​ scores
  • Behavioral Data: Attendance,⁤ participation, feedback loops
  • Communication Data: Chat ⁤logs, forum posts, emails

The proliferation of such data brings unique challenges and responsibilities, particularly as education⁣ increasingly moves online and crosses international borders.

Common Data Privacy Risks ⁤in edtech

EdTech platforms must navigate a complex landscape of data privacy risks. Key concerns include:

  • Unauthorized Data Access: Hackers or even staff accessing sensitive student information​ without consent.
  • Data Breaches: cyberattacks leading to leaks of personal or academic information.
  • Third-Party ⁣Sharing: EdTech vendors may share ​or⁢ sell data to advertisers or analytics firms without users’ knowledge.
  • Insufficient Data⁤ Encryption: Unencrypted data⁣ can be ‍intercepted and abused.
  • Compliance⁢ Violations: failing to adhere to regulations like ⁢FERPA (Family​ Educational Rights and Privacy Act), COPPA⁣ (Children’s ‍Online Privacy Protection Act), or GDPR (General Data Protection Regulation).

These risks are compounded by the rapid pace of EdTech innovation and the varying levels of ⁤digital literacy​ among educators,​ students, and parents.

Case Study: Navigating ‍a ‍Data Breach in EdTech

Consider the example​ of a ⁣widely-used ⁣school LMS that experienced a major data breach​ in 2022. The attackers exploited weak⁣ passwords and⁢ outdated software to access:

  • Student names and IDs
  • Grade reports
  • Emails ⁤and contact details

The response involved:

  1. Immediate system lockdown and password resets.
  2. clear communication ⁢ with affected parties,‌ parents, and regulatory bodies.
  3. Hiring cybersecurity experts to audit ⁣and strengthen defenses.
  4. Review and revision ‍of privacy policies and vendor contracts.

The lesson? Proactive privacy protocols, clear communication, and ongoing technical investments ⁣are⁣ critical to mitigating damage‌ and restoring trust after an‌ incident.

Practical Tips and Solutions for Data Privacy in EdTech

1. Establish Clear Privacy Policies

Make privacy policies ⁣accessible and understandable for all users. Specify what data is collected,how it’s used,and who⁣ can access it.

2. Limit ‍Data Collection

Only collect data necessary for educational ‌outcomes. Avoid⁣ storing unnecessary personal or behavioral details.

3. ⁤Use Strong ​Data Encryption

Encrypt data both at‌ rest and in transit to‍ prevent unauthorized⁤ access.

4. Regular Security‌ Audits

Schedule periodic audits of your EdTech system’s security protocols ‍and update them as needed.

5. Secure ⁢Partnerships and Vendor Vetting

Review contracts‌ with third-party⁢ providers and ensure their privacy practices align ‌with your standards.

6. Invest in Staff ‍Training

Educators and administrators should be trained on privacy awareness,cyber hygiene,and responsible data handling.

7. Foster Student and ​Parent Awareness

  • Educate students about⁢ online privacy⁢ and ​safe technology use.
  • Empower parents‍ with information about how their children’s data is managed.

8. Follow Legal Regulations

Stay current with privacy​ laws like FERPA, GDPR, COPPA.Consult with legal experts as regulations evolve.

First-Hand Experience: An Educator’s Perspective

“As a technology integration specialist in ‍a K-12 school, I​ witnessed firsthand the importance‌ of data privacy ⁤in EdTech. Early in our‌ transition to digital tools,‌ we discovered a gap in our understanding‌ of how ⁣third-party apps handled student ⁤information.by collaborating with our IT ‌department, we established a checklist for reviewing ⁢all digital⁣ platforms—ensuring each met strict data privacy standards and provided transparent terms of service.

The proactive approach paid off: when parents inquired about​ data security, we​ confidently explained our processes and reassured them about the safety of ‌their‍ children’s information. ​Our⁢ students also benefitted from privacy lessons built into the curriculum, ⁤fostering a culture of responsible⁤ digital citizenship.”

Future‍ Trends and Emerging Solutions

The ⁣intersection of AI‌ in EdTech, cloud computing, and personalized learning demands new​ strategies for safeguarding data privacy:

  • AI-Powered security: ⁢Real-time monitoring for suspicious activity and automated breach detection.
  • Decentralized Data ‍Models: ⁣ Reducing‌ centralized risks by⁢ distributing⁤ data⁢ across multiple protected nodes.
  • Enhanced Parental controls: ​User-friendly dashboards for​ parents to review and manage their‌ child’s privacy settings.
  • Privacy-By-Design: ‌Integrating privacy at every stage of EdTech product development.

As ⁢technology evolves, EdTech providers must stay‍ agile, committing ⁢to ongoing learning and transparent communication.
